What fence materials hold up best against Vinita Park's soil and pests?

Given the moderate soil corrosivity and moderate-to-heavy termite risk, use pressure-treated wood rated for ground contact or corrosion-resistant metals like aluminum. For fasteners, use hot-dipped galvanized or stainless steel to prevent rust streaks. Avoid untreated wood posts in direct soil contact.

What are the critical steps before digging fence post holes?

First, contact Missouri 811 for a utility locate at least three business days before digging. Hitting a gas or fiber line in Vinita Park is a major liability. Second, file any required permit paperwork with the Vinita Park City Hall permit office. This two-step process is non-negotiable for a legal, safe installation.

How deep should fence posts be set in Vinita Park?

Posts must be set a minimum of 30 inches deep to reach below the local frost line. The International Residential Code requires this for stability against frost heave. Posts set shallower in Vinita Park Residential soils will lift and fail within 1-2 winters.
